NAME
skb_recycle_check - check if skb can be reused for receive
SYNOPSIS
int skb_recycle_check(struct sk_buff * skb, int skb_size);
ARGUMENTS
skb buffer skb_size minimum receive buffer size
DESCRIPTION
Checks that the skb passed in is not shared or cloned, and that it is linear and its head portion at least as large as skb_size so that it can be recycled as a receive buffer. If these conditions are met, this function does any necessary reference count dropping and cleans up the skbuff as if it just came from __alloc_skb.
